Output ef5e9d5987561d7a216f453539e155c7e645e1dcb297ffff2aebd662ce0ce236:203

value
16384
script pubkey
OP_0 OP_PUSHBYTES_20 105b71a3b9c6539b2d47866b65f08450f53a16b4
address
bc1qzpdhrgaecefekt28se4ktuyy2r6n59450eg37u
transaction
ef5e9d5987561d7a216f453539e155c7e645e1dcb297ffff2aebd662ce0ce236
confirmations
160506
spent
true